Hey Leaky, its ok that you went ahead and posted up. I will throw my report on here even though I didn't get my film developed yet. Wendy (the girlfriend) had a graduation to go to so I didn't have the digital this time. Anyway, I got there early,... about six thirty. I fished all along the tule's and didn't get anything. I was fishing the bobber rig that the Dude showed me. About the time that Leaky pulled up, I finally got my first bite and fought in a kittie that went about four pounds. I'm just guestimating here because I don't have an accurate scale that I can take. ANyway, I kicked back over to Leaky's launch point because I wanted to fish with he and Sparky. We worked north along the shore and caught fish along the cattails for the most part. It seemed like everytime we'd put a bobber tight to the cattails, we'd get a bite. I had caught about three channels, with one going probably eight or nine pounds (big old daddy cat). To date, I believe thats the biggest catfish I've ever caught out of this spot.... [cool] It was AWESOME!!! Leaky finally got his bobber on track and it went down... he had hooked into a mudcat. I tried to give him credit for ditching the skunk but he wouldn't take it unless it was a channel cat. Well, I let him kick over in front of me and fish a spot where cattails and tules mixed and WHAM.... as soon as he cast his bobber out, he looked away for a sec and it disappeared. That was definitely one of the highlights of the day... watching my good bud hook into his first good channel cat out of Utah Lake. We kept catching fish and I gave him some fresh carp meat to try... I believe thats what his first cat came on. Anyway, he was fishing the cattail point so I kicked around on the north side of him to keep working up the shore. I fished up against the cattails and in and out of the little cuts along the weedline and was doing really well.... About every fifteen minutes or so, the bobber would disappear and I'd have another fish. There were some times when I messed around with bait and hooks and that and wasted time but I fished pretty hard and did really well as long as I fished right next to the weeds. I caught several pretty large fish but I'd say the average was around 4-6 pounds. I did catch another really big blue headed daddy channel cat and it has to be the ugliest fish I've seen. It looked mostly normal except for the face. His left eye was all grown over, basically covered with transparent skin. It was all bloodshot looking and his mouth was all torn up too. The other side of his face was ok, but man, he was just an awful looking gray color and was ugly as sin. He put up a good fight and because he was so big, I let him go as well. Anyway, on the day, I fished for about 8 hours, caught 14-16 cats... I didn't really keep count. It was sure fun though. I was kinda worried because I didn't catch a fish all morning until Leaky showed up and then he had trouble getting on fish at first but once we figured them out, it was fast fishing... as fast as catfishing can really be I guess....
